davewhit Posted July 7, 2020 Posted July 7, 2020 Hi guys silly question so forgive me as i am still new to all the Duma stuff, i have just upgraded my net to 1Gig and when i go to my QOS to up grade my Bufferbloat it wont let me go above 1000mbs as it says invalid download speed, any help please as virgin say i should get about 1150mbs top
Administrators Netduma Fraser Posted July 7, 2020 Administrators Posted July 7, 2020 The router can only support a maximum of 1gbps so 1000mbps, that's the maximum speed you can input there. If you had an XR700 and used SFP+ you could achieve higher than 1gbps.
